Depending on your experience, availability and interests, roles may include:
Teaching Assistant
Support pupils during lessons, help them complete activities and encourage their confidence and independence.
Cover Supervisor
Supervise secondary school classes and deliver work that has been prepared by the absent teacher.
❤️ ALN Support Assistant
Provide one-to-one or small-group support for pupils with Additional Learning Needs.
Learning or Behaviour Mentor
Build positive relationships with pupils who need additional encouragement to engage with school and learning.
SEN/ALN School Support
Support pupils with a range of learning, communication, sensory, physical or behavioural needs in specialist settings.
